Moral injury is the damage done to ones conscience or moral compass when that person perpetrates witnesses or fails to prevent acts that transgress ones own moral beliefs values or ethical codes of conduct. Morality from Latin moralitas manner character proper behavior is the differentiation of intentions decisions and actions between those that are distinguished as proper right and those that are improper wrong.
